linux 显示内存被什么占用了
时间: 2023-09-30 10:09:47 浏览: 93
Linux查看进程的内存占用情况
在 Linux 终端中,可以使用 `free` 命令查看当前系统内存使用情况,包括已用内存、空闲内存、缓存等信息。命令如下:
```
free -h
```
其中,`-h` 参数表示以人类可读的方式显示内存使用情况,单位为 GB、MB 等。
如果想查看更详细的内存使用情况,可以使用 `top` 命令,它可以实时显示系统资源使用情况。在 `top` 命令中,按下 M 键可以按内存使用情况排序,按下 P 键可以按 CPU 使用情况排序。命令如下:
```
top
```
此外,还可以使用 `ps` 命令查看进程的内存使用情况。命令如下:
```
ps aux --sort=-%mem
```
其中,`--sort=-%mem` 表示按照内存使用情况倒序排序,可以看到占用内存最多的进程。
阅读全文